Biography

Known as the "Master of the Quiet Storm," bassist Gary Taylor played sideman on dozens of albums during the 1960s, '70s, and '80s, and became a fixture of his own on adult contemporary radio with his own recordings, beginning with 1991's Take Control. Albums followed for Sindrome and Morning Crew during the '90s. ~ John Bush, All Music Guide
